Concrete Driveway Sealing in Kitsap County, WA

Concrete driveway sealing services involve applying a protective coating to existing concrete surfaces to enhance durability and appearance. This process helps prevent damage from water, chemicals, and weather elements, extending the lifespan of the driveway. Projects typically include sealing residential driveways, parking areas, and pathways, providing a fresh look while safeguarding the concrete from cracks, staining, and surface deterioration. Homeowners often seek this service to maintain curb appeal, reduce maintenance needs, and protect their investment in property exterior features.

Before requesting concrete driveway sealing, property owners usually want to understand the condition of the existing surface, including any cracks or damage that may need addressing beforehand. It's also helpful to know the types of sealers available and their suitability for specific driveway conditions and usage. Pro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and repairs, is essential for the best results, and understanding the expected lifespan of the sealant can aid in planning future maintenance. Clear communication about the scope and materials used ensures the sealing process meets the property's needs.

FAQ

Concrete Driveway Sealing Questions

What is concrete driveway sealing? It is a protective coating applied to extend the lifespan of a driveway and improve its appearance.

When should a driveway be sealed? Sealing is typically recommended every few years to prevent cracks and surface damage.

What benefits does sealing provide? Sealing helps resist stains, reduces surface wear, and maintains the driveway’s look over time.

Can sealing fix existing cracks? Sealing can help prevent new cracks from forming, but it does not repair existing damage.
